Is there any way of limiting access to pptpd from pocket pc clients ?
I cant find any fingerprints for pocket pc in pf.os ?
Steve
/usr/ports/net/poptop works excellently.
pf needs to allow protocol 47 and tcp 1723 plus need to allow traffic
for specific tunnels created tun0 tun1 etc.
Generally the client will determine whether to use the created link as
default route. If using windows check the tcp/ip
